After Gators’ former defensive defender Jalen Tabor said that Alabama’s Marco Wilson will ‘lock up’ DeVonta Smith in Saturday’s Southeastern Conference Championship showdown, another Florida member has made a shot at the Crimson Tide.

Trevon Grimes, a senior from Fort Lauderdale, Florida, sees the Gators win the game.

The 6-foot-4, 218-pounder at wide receiver has 34 catches for 511 yards and eight touchdowns. In an interview he had with reporters, Grimes didn’t hold back when it came to filming Alabama.

“We know this is going to be a dog fight,” said Grimes. “We know we will emerge victorious.”

Despite a 34-37 defeat to LSU at Ben Hill Griffin Stadium last week, Florida is confident how it will match the Tide at Mercedes-Benz Stadium in Atlanta. As Nick Saban and Alabama pursue their seventh SEC title, the Gators are on the hunt for the first conference crown since 2008 with Tim Tebow.
